Healthy Marriages are the Foundation of Healthy Homes
“Therefore a man shall leave his father and his mother and hold fast to his wife, and they shall become one flesh.”— Genesis 2:24
1. Leave
“Therefore a man shall leave his father and his mother…
We must leave our parents.
2. Cleave
Marriage is not contractual; it’s covenantal.
“‘Therefore a man shall leave his father and mother and hold fast to his wife, and the two shall become one flesh.’ This mystery is profound, and I am saying that it refers to Christ and the church.”
3. Become “One-flesh.”
“Therefore a man shall leave his father and his mother and hold fast to his wife, and they shall become one flesh.”
Marriage Belongs to God
“For God knows that when you eat of it your eyes will be opened, and you will be like God, knowing good and evil.”
When leaving becomes an issue, stress becomes the norm.
If we don’t cleave to each other, we will cleave to something (or someone).
If you want a healthy marriage, you must have healthy hearts.
“And I will give you a new heart, and a new spirit I will put within you. And I will remove the heart of stone from your flesh and give you a heart of flesh.”
“Therefore, if anyone is in Christ, he is a new creation. The old has passed away; behold the new has come. All this is from God, who through Christ reconciled us to himself and gave us the ministry of reconciliation…”
“Truly, truly, I say to you, unless one is born again he cannot see the kingdom of God…”
